首页/vpn加速器/深入解析VPN配置,从基础到进阶的网络工程师实战指南

深入解析VPN配置,从基础到进阶的网络工程师实战指南

在当今高度互联的数字世界中,虚拟私人网络(VPN)已成为企业和个人用户保障网络安全、访问受限资源和实现远程办公的重要工具,作为一名网络工程师,我经常被问及如何正确配置一个稳定、安全且高效的VPN服务,本文将从基础概念出发,结合实际部署经验,带你系统掌握VPN的配置流程与常见问题处理技巧。

明确什么是VPN,它是一种通过公共网络(如互联网)建立加密隧道的技术,使远程用户或分支机构能够像在局域网内部一样安全地访问私有网络资源,常见的VPN类型包括点对点协议(PPTP)、IPsec、SSL/TLS(OpenVPN、WireGuard等),其中IPsec和OpenVPN因安全性高、兼容性好,成为企业级部署的首选。

接下来是配置步骤,以OpenVPN为例,我们分四步走:

第一步:环境准备,确保服务器端具备公网IP地址,并开放UDP 1194端口(默认),若使用云服务商(如阿里云、AWS),需配置安全组规则允许该端口入站流量,在客户端设备上安装OpenVPN客户端软件,例如OpenVPN Connect或官方Windows/Linux版本。

第二步:生成证书和密钥,这是最核心的安全环节,使用EasyRSA工具创建CA根证书、服务器证书和客户端证书,每台客户端都需要独立证书,避免共享密钥带来的风险,建议启用证书吊销列表(CRL)机制,便于后续管理异常设备。

第三步:编写配置文件,服务器端配置文件(server.conf)需定义子网掩码(如10.8.0.0/24)、TLS密钥交换方式(推荐tls-crypt)、日志级别等,客户端配置文件(client.ovpn)则包含服务器地址、证书路径、加密算法(如AES-256-CBC)等参数,务必设置“auth-user-pass”选项,强制用户输入用户名密码双重认证,提升防护等级。

第四步:测试与优化,启动服务后,用客户端连接并观察日志输出是否成功建立隧道,若出现“TLS handshake failed”错误,应检查证书过期时间或时区同步问题;若连接缓慢,可尝试调整MTU值或启用UDP加速模式,建议部署负载均衡器(如HAProxy)或集群架构,提升高并发场景下的稳定性。

最后提醒几个关键点:一是定期更新OpenVPN版本,修补已知漏洞;二是记录操作日志,便于故障追溯;三是遵循最小权限原则,为不同用户分配差异化访问权限。

正确的VPN配置不仅是技术活,更是安全意识的体现,作为网络工程师,我们不仅要让数据畅通无阻,更要让它安全可靠,掌握上述方法,你就能在复杂网络环境中游刃有余地构建起一道无形的数字护城河。

深入解析VPN配置,从基础到进阶的网络工程师实战指南

本文转载自互联网,如有侵权,联系删除